Frame synchronization is quickly established to acquire an RF channel in a short time. Numerically controlled oscillators 1 - 1 to 1 - 3 , complex calculation circuits 2 - 1 to 2 - 3 , band limit filters 3 - 1 to 3 - 3 , a selector 7 , a phase error detection circuit 9 , a loop filter 10 , and an AFC circuit 11 compose a carrier regeneration loop for removing the frequency error of the carrier included in an in-phase component I and a quadrant component Q of the baseband signal input to the complex calculation circuits 2 - 1 to 2 - 3 . A timing generator 6 detects which of frame synchronization pattern detection circuits 5 - 1 to 5 - 3 has detected a frame synchronization pattern, provides the selector 7 with a selection signal corresponding to the decision result, and sends a switch signal to the AFC circuit 11 . Thereafter, the carrier for removing the frequency error included in the baseband signal is regenerated to acquire an RF channel in a short time.
